Ok, I have a few questions regarding my transmission. First off I have a 93 d250. If I remember correctly I have a 46rh? I want to eventually make my truck 4wd.
Now, I understand most people will tell me its better to just get a 4wd truck to make it easier on myself for wanting 4wd. However, I like a project so I was thinking of just upgrading my truck little by little. As I understand it the same transmission is used for both 4wd drive and 2wd trucks. The difference being an extension housing. First where can I get an extension housing online? If not online then I'll just have to keep looking at the junk yards or for a donor truck. Also is the extension housing all I need? Or do I need to do anything to the rest of the transmission? I know I'll need a transfer case and a front axle, but for now I'm just thinking about the transmission. Oh, and a shortened drive shaft.

Actually I believe they call yours an A518, 46RH was the V8 trans with LU starting in 1994.
But yea, you can change yours over by getting the OD unit and 205 transfer case.
All A518/RH OD units will work, including gassers, but you will have to build it up to diesel specs with clutch plates/steels.
This technically should be in the first gen section, as for changing yours to 4X4, there is a really good thread happening right now on how to do it.
